Muscle Relaxant Drugs Market Segmentation:
Drug Type Segment Analysis
The prescription-based segment is poised to register the highest share of 68.6% in the market over the assessed period. These medications, specifically non-benzodiazepine, are gaining prominence in this sector on account of their lower addiction risk. As per the NLM report in June 2025, non-benzodiazepine muscle relaxants (MR) for acute low back pain (LBP) showed increased pain relief (Risk Ratio: 0.53, p<0.0001). As more clinical studies confirm their reduced sedation ability compared to benzodiazepines, a greater number of physicians are considering and suggesting muscle relaxants as a gold standard and safer long-term option for chronic pain management.
Distribution Channel Segment Analysis
The hospital pharmacies segment is poised to be positioned as the leading source of revenue generation from the field of application in the market throughout the discussed timeframe. Testifying to the same, the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) revealed that around 50.7% of candidates undergoing interventional treatments require muscle relaxants during their recovery. This reflects the high-volume utilization of muscle relaxants in hospitals. Besides, the presence of government subsidies attracts both consumers and manufacturers to prioritize this segment. Testifying to the same, the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) started providing reimbursement for 80.4% of in-hospital prescriptions.
Route of Administration Segment Analysis
Oral formulations are estimated to show dominance in the market by the end of 2035. The convenience and patient preference are the major factors behind the leadership. Widespread clinical acceptance of tablets and capsules for treating both acute and chronic conditions is also influencing pharma giants to invest more in this form of medication. As per the NLM report in August 2022, oral drugs such as cyclobenzaprine and baclofen account for the majority of skeletal muscle relaxant prescriptions; cyclobenzaprine accounts for 50% of muscle relaxant prescriptions Moreover, the oral drug delivery system remains the gold standard for outpatient treatment, which offers the option for cost-effective dosing without requiring medical supervision. These are cumulatively fostering a greater volume of users for this category.
